The Festo Wall Mounting (5225721) is a specialized mounting attachment designed for production facilities manufacturing lithium-ion batteries. This robust mounting solution provides secure and stable wall installation for Festo components, ensuring optimal positioning and performance in battery production environments. Engineered to withstand industrial conditions, it offers reliable support for automation equipment, sensors, and control systems. The 5225721 model is compatible with various Festo products, facilitating efficient integration into existing production lines while maximizing space utilization in battery manufacturing facilities.
